Dell EMC PowerEdge XE7100 Installation and Service Manual

Removing the rear intrusion switch

Prerequisites

  1. Follow the safety guidelines listed in safety instructions.
  2. Follow the procedure listed in the Before working inside your system.
  3. Remove the rear system cover.
  4. Remove the rear drive cage
  5. Remove the PDB.

Steps

  1. Disconnect and remove the intrusion switch cable from the connector on the system board.

    Observe the routing of the cable as you remove it from the chassis.

  2. Remove the screws securing the switch bracket to the PDB module and move it away from the module.
  3. Remove the intrusion switch from the chassis.
